摘要:
 植被退化是影响陆地生态系统和气候变化的一个重要因素,分析植被退化特征对植被生态治理与保护具有重要意义。应用Mann-Kendall法对2000-2011年岛状冻土区的植被退化过程及影响植被退化的驱动因素进行分析。结果表明,植被退化区域占整个研究区面积的15.05%,其中严重退化区域比例占1.42%,其余13.63%为轻微退化;退化区域主要分布于北黑高速路段两侧地区、东北部大河口林场外围区域及河漫滩周围的沼泽地;降水量与植被指数表现为正相关性,显著性P<0.05,而气温显著性P>0.05,说明降水量是植被生长的主导因子;冻土退化产生地面渗水现象,归一化植被指数骤降0.26,同时在Mann-Kendall趋势曲线中突变点发生于2006年;岛状冻土退化伴随着土壤温度梯度发生显著的变化,植物的水分传导性脆弱,生长将受到抑制作用。研究结果可为高寒区生态系统的稳定发展和探寻水热条件变化规律提供空间数据支撑。
Abstract:
 Vegetation degradation is a significant factor in ecological degradation,which directly affects terrestrial ecosystems and climate change.Analyzing the character of vegetation degradation is of importance for ecological management and protection.In this paper,Mann-Kendall test was used for discussing the trends of vegetation degradation and degraded factor from 2000 to 2011 island-shaped permafrost (ISP) zone in the high-latitude.The results showed that the area of degraded vegetation accounted for 15.05% of the total area,of which 1.42% was seriously degraded and 13.63% was slightly degraded.Vegetation degradation region was mainly in the both sides of highway from Heihe to Beian,peripheral region of the northeast of the Dahekou woodland and the surroundings of floodplain marshes.Precipitation was positively correlated with vegetation index (P<0.05) and atmospheric temperature(P>0.05) ,indicating that the precipitation was the dominant factor of vegetation growth.With the degradation of ISP,there existed a ground water seepage phenomenon,and the normalized vegetation index dropped 0.26.The mutation point occurred in the Mann-Kendall trend curve in 2006.Meanwhile,permafrost degradation along with the soil temperature gradient had significant changes,and plant water conductivity becaome fragile,which inhibited vegetation growth.The results would provide spatial data support for the stable development of the ecosystem of alpine region and the exploration of hydrothermal condition variation.
